Effect Of Qingjiehuagong Method On Intestinal Barrier Function In Patients With Mild Acute Pancreatitis

Objective:This study aims to investigate the effect of Qingjiehuagong method on intestinal mucosal barrier function in patients with mild acute pancreatitis.By observing the improvement of symptoms and signs,the change trend of inflammatory index and intestinal mucosal monitoring index,recording the incidence of complications and total clinical efficacy.Then we can understand the clinical effect and mechanism of Qingjiehuagong method in treating patients with mild acute pancreatitis.So as to provide scientific basis for application of Qingjiehuagong method in the treatment of mild acute pancreatitis.Methods:Collected 40 MAP patients who met the inclusion criteria then divided into control group and observation group according to the treatment plan selected by the patients,each group has 20 patients.The control group was treated with Inhibition of gastric acid secretion,inhibition of pancreatic enzyme secretion and rehydration support therapy.On the basis of the control group,the observation group was treated combined with Qingjiehuagong method.In the course of treatment,the symptoms?abdominal pain,nausea and vomiting?and signs?bowel sounds?of the two groups were closely observed.On the first day,the third day and the seventh day after admission,the related indexes of inflammation and intestinal mucosal barrier function were detected.In addition,both groups'incidence rate of complication,effective rate of clinical treatment and the hospitalization time would be recorded.Results:?1?In terms of comprehensive curative effect,according to the evaluation criteria of curative effect of the disease,there were no complications in both groups,the both groups'total efficiency of clinical treatment was the same ?P>0.05?.?2?In terms of the improvement time of clinical symptoms and signs,the time of abdominal distension,abdominal pain,nausea and vomiting,and the time of recovery of bowel sounds in the observation group were significantly less than those in the control group?P<0.05?.It indicates that the effect of improving symptoms and signs in the observation group is better than the control group.?3?In terms of the inflammatory index,comparing the index within the first week of admission,both groups'change trend are approximately the same.Moreover,the CRP numerical value of the observation group on the 3rdand 7thdays decreased more significantly than that of the control group ?P<0.05?,suggesting that the effect of the observation group on control inflammation was better than that of the control group.?4?In terms of the serum DAO,comparing the index within the first week of admission,both groups'change trend are approximately the same.Moreover,the observation group decreased more significantly on the 3rdand7thdays than control group?P<0.05?,suggesting that the protective effect of the observation group on intestinal barrier function was better than that in the control group.?5?In terms of the serum D-lactate,comparing the index within the first week of admission,both groups'change trend are approximately the same.Moreover,the observation group decreased more significantly than control group on the 3rdday?P<0.05?,suggesting that the protective effect of the observation group on intestinal barrier function was better than that in the control group.On the 7thday,both groups'index have no difference?P>0.05?,suggesting that the protective effect of two groups on intestinal barrier function were the same.?6?In terms of length of stay,the length of stay in the observation group was significantly shorter than that in the control group,suggested that the effect of the observation group in shortening the treatment period is better than that of the control group.Conclusions:?1?The application of combined Qingjiehuagong method in the routine treatment scheme of western medicine can effectively improve MAP patients'clinical symptoms and signs.Besides,Qingjiehuagong method can control the inflammatory reaction better,protect the function of intestinal barrier function better.?2?The mechanism of Qingjiehuagong Method in treating MAP may be related to inhibiting inflammation,promoting gastrointestinal peristalsis, protecting intestinal barrier function and regulating intestinal flora.?3?Qingjiehuagong method has defined the prescription,dosage and drug administration of the MAP Chinese medicine therapeutic regimen.It guaranteed the effectiveness and can be widespread used.Qingjiehuagong method is beneficial to expand the influence of Chinese medicine and and plays an important synergistic role in the treatment of MAP by Chinese medicine.
